Abstract

This invention discloses an injection molding production equipment for plastic shock-absorbing pads, relating to the field of shock-absorbing pad injection molding technology. It includes a base, an injection mechanism and a mold mounted on top of the base. The mold is movable on the top of the base. A positioning plate is located on one side of the base, a positioning sleeve is fixed to the top of the positioning plate, and a movable sleeve is located inside the positioning sleeve and can move up and down within it. A negative pressure unit is located inside the movable sleeve, and a cutter is located on both sides of the top of the positioning sleeve and can move centrally on the top of the positioning sleeve. The advantages of this invention are: after the mold opens, it can automatically pick up the shock-absorbing pad material, avoiding safety hazards such as pinching and bumping caused by close contact with the mold by manual labor, greatly improving the safety and stability of equipment production. Furthermore, during the material picking process, residual waste material on the shock-absorbing pad can be trimmed, allowing for uniform trimming force and precision, effectively avoiding problems such as residual burrs, over-trimming, and product deformation that occur with manual trimming.

Technical Field

[0001] This invention relates to the field of injection molding technology for shock-absorbing pads, and in particular to injection molding production equipment for plastic shock-absorbing pads. Background Technology

[0002] Currently, most shock-absorbing pads on the market are mass-produced using injection molding technology. The core production equipment used is an injection molding machine. The entire set of equipment mainly consists of an injection system, a mold clamping system, a temperature control system, a hydraulic transmission system, and matching molds. During production, the raw material is heated and plasticized by the equipment and then injected into the mold cavity under high pressure. After cooling and solidification, the shock-absorbing pad is formed. Subsequently, the injection molding machine drives the mold to complete the mold opening action. After the mold is opened, the operator manually removes the formed shock-absorbing pads one by one from the cavity. At the same time, the flash, sprue, and other waste generated by injection molding at the product edges are trimmed by hand tools.

[0003] Manual close contact with the mold during operation poses safety hazards such as pinching and bumping, resulting in poor operational safety. Furthermore, the force and angle of manual trimming of waste materials cannot be standardized, which can easily lead to over-trimming, residual burrs, and other problems. This results in insufficient consistency in the appearance and size of the finished shock-absorbing pads, making it difficult to guarantee the product yield. Summary of the Invention

[0033] Example 1, referring to Figure 1 and Figure 2 , Figures 7-10 This is the first embodiment of the present invention. This embodiment provides an injection molding production equipment for plastic shock-absorbing pads, including a base 1, an injection mechanism 2 and a mold 3 disposed on the top of the base 1. A raw material conveying pipe is connected to one side of the injection mechanism 2 for conveying heated raw material into the injection mechanism 2. The mold 3 can move on the top of the base 1. The mold 3 includes an upper mold and a lower mold. An opening mechanism is provided on the top of the base 1 for opening the upper mold upward. When the mold 3 moves to the bottom of the injection mechanism 2, the injection mechanism 2 presses down and inserts the injection needle into the injection hole on the mold 3 to complete the injection of raw material, thereby completing the processing and molding of the shock-absorbing pad. This is the prior art, and this solution will not be described in detail. Moreover, those skilled in the art can clearly understand the working principle.

[0034] Positioning plate 4 is located on one side of base 1, positioning sleeve 5 is fixed on top of positioning plate 4, bottom of positioning sleeve 5 penetrates positioning plate 4, and the number is consistent with the mold holes on mold 3. Positioning sleeve 5 is tapered at the top, the diameter of the top of positioning sleeve 5 is the same as that of shock-absorbing pad, and the diameter of the bottom is larger than that of shock-absorbing pad.

[0035] The movable sleeve 6 is located inside the positioning sleeve 5 and can move up and down within the positioning sleeve 5. The diameter of the movable sleeve 6 is the same as that of the shock-absorbing pad. The negative pressure unit 7 is located inside the movable sleeve 6.

[0036] After the upper mold is opened, the positioning plate 4 is moved to the bottom of the upper mold and the positioning sleeve 5 is aligned with the shock-absorbing pad. At this time, the positioning plate 4 drives the positioning sleeve 5 to move upward, and the shock-absorbing pad is inserted into the positioning sleeve 5 and the moving sleeve 6. Then the positioning plate 4 is moved downward. At this time, with the cooperation of the negative pressure unit 7, the moving sleeve 6 will firmly suck up the shock-absorbing pad and drive the shock-absorbing pad to move downward and separate from the upper mold, thereby completing the removal of the shock-absorbing pad. This avoids the safety hazards such as pinching and bumping caused by close contact between the manual and the mold, greatly improving the safety and stability of the equipment production. Moreover, the removal of the shock-absorbing pad by negative pressure adsorption can effectively avoid damage to the shock-absorbing pad.

[0037] The cutter 8 is located on both sides of the top of the positioning sleeve 5 and can move in the center of the top of the positioning sleeve 5. There are two cutters 8 on the top of the positioning sleeve 5, located on both sides of the top of the positioning sleeve 5 respectively. The cutter 8 has a semi-circular notch, and the inner side of the semi-circular notch is set as a blade. When the cutter 8 is cutting, it will not be obstructed by the screw at the center of the shock absorber block, which will prevent it from merging.

[0038] The support plate 9 is fixed to the bottom of the positioning plate 4 by the mounting rod. The relative position of the support plate 9 and the positioning plate 4 is fixed. The connecting column 10 is fixed to the bottom of the movable sleeve 6, and the bottom end is fixed with a connecting frame 11. The number of connecting columns 10 corresponds to the movable sleeve 6, and is used to connect and fix multiple movable sleeves 6 to the connecting frame 11. The first cylinder 12 is fixed on the support plate 9, and the output end is fixed to the connecting frame 11.

[0039] The rotating unit 13 is located on the top of the positioning plate 4 and is connected to the cutter 8 and the connecting frame 11 respectively.

[0040] After the positioning plate 4 moves the shock-absorbing pad out of the upper mold, the first cylinder 12 is activated to move the connecting frame 11 and the moving sleeve 6 downward. The moving sleeve 6 moves the shock-absorbing pad downward to the positioning sleeve 5. When the top of the shock-absorbing pad is flush with the top port of the positioning sleeve 5, the rotating unit 13 will drive the cutter 8 to move in the center. The cutter 8 will trim and remove the waste material remaining on the top of the shock-absorbing pad. The trimming can be uniform in terms of trimming force and precision, effectively avoiding problems such as burrs, over-trimming, and product deformation that occur with manual trimming.

[0041] The moving unit 14 is mounted on the support plate 9 and is used to move and lift the support plate 9.

[0042] Example 2, refer to Figures 3-9 This is the second embodiment of the present invention, which is based on the previous embodiment.

[0043] Specifically, the negative pressure unit 7 includes a sealing plate 71 located at the bottom of the movable sleeve 6, with a vent hole at the bottom of the movable sleeve 6. The sealing plate 71 seals the vent hole. A support column 72 is fixed at the bottom of the sealing plate 71. A stabilizing frame 73 is fixed at the bottom of the movable sleeve 6. The stabilizing frame 73 is U-shaped. The support column 72 is movably connected to the stabilizing frame 73. The two cooperate to support and position the sealing plate 71. The two ends of the spring 74 are fixed to the stabilizing frame 73 and the sealing plate 71, respectively.

[0044] When the shock-absorbing pad moves into the movable sleeve 6, the air pressure generated by the movement of the shock-absorbing pad will push the sealing plate 71 to open. At this time, it will not hinder the movement of the shock-absorbing pad into the movable sleeve 6. When the shock-absorbing pad stops moving, the spring 74 will apply an upward thrust to the sealing plate 71, so that the sealing plate 71 seals the vent. When the movable sleeve 6 moves downward, a negative pressure will be formed between the bottom of the shock-absorbing pad and the movable sleeve 6, so that the shock-absorbing pad cannot be separated from the movable sleeve 6. Thus, the shock-absorbing pad can be driven to move downward through the movable sleeve 6.

[0045] The negative pressure unit 7 also includes a pusher 75 inserted into the movable sleeve 6. There are two pushers 75 inside the movable sleeve 6, which are inserted into the two sides inside the movable sleeve 6 respectively. The tops of the two pushers are connected and fixed by a push plate. The center of the rotating rod 76 is hinged to the bottom of the movable sleeve 6 by a hinge rod. The connecting shaft 77 is fixed to the bottom of the sealing plate 71. One end of the rotating rod 76 is connected to the connecting shaft 77 through a sliding groove. The squeezing sleeve 78 is located outside the pusher 75. The squeezing sleeve 78 is connected to the pusher 75 by friction, and the friction between the two is greater than the elastic force of the spring 74. The limiting rod 79 is fixed to the bottom of the movable sleeve 6. The limiting rod 79 is L-shaped.

[0046] When the shock-absorbing pad enters the movable sleeve 6, it will push the push column 75 to move downward. At this time, the push column 75 will drive the compression sleeve 78 to move downward. When the compression sleeve 78 contacts the end of the limit rod 79, it will be obstructed and unable to move. At this time, the push column 75 will counteract the friction between itself and the compression sleeve 78 and continue to move downward.

[0047] When the connecting frame 11 moves the movable sleeve 6 downward, the bottom end of the push column 75 will contact the support plate 9 and move upward under the reverse thrust of the support plate 9. At this time, the push column 75 will move the extrusion sleeve 78 upward, causing the extrusion sleeve 78 to push one end of the rotating rod 76 upward. At this time, the other end of the rotating rod 76 will move the sealing plate 71 downward through the cooperation of the sliding groove and the connecting shaft 77, and release the negative pressure state between the shock-absorbing pad and the movable sleeve 6. When the push column 75 moves upward, it will push the shock-absorbing pad upward away from the movable sleeve 6, thereby completing the feeding of the shock-absorbing pad.

[0048] The rotating unit 13 includes a positioning rod 131 fixed to the bottom of the cutter 8. The bottom of the cutter 8 is fixed with positioning rods 131 on both sides. The rotating column 132 is rotatably connected to the top of the positioning plate 4 through a stabilizing block, and its two ends are respectively inserted into the two positioning rods 131. The rotating column 132 has a spiral groove 1321 at both ends. The spiral directions of the two spiral grooves 1321 are opposite, and the pitch of the spiral groove 1321 is large. The fixed shaft 133 is fixed on the positioning plate 4 and is slidably connected to the spiral groove 1321.

[0049] When the rotating column 132 rotates, the fixed shaft 133 will slide in the spiral groove 1321. The two work together to drive the positioning rod 131 and the cutter 8 to move, so that the cutter 8 can trim and remove the waste material remaining on the top of the shock-absorbing pad.

[0050] Because of the large pitch of the spiral groove 1321, the cutter 8 will move a long distance when the rotating column 132 rotates at a very small angle, so that the waste material can be quickly removed during the downward movement of the shock-absorbing pad.

[0051] The rotating unit 13 also includes a force-bearing rod 134 fixed to the end of the rotating column 132, a connecting rod 135 fixed to one side of the connecting frame 11, and its top end extending through to the top of the positioning plate 4. The positioning plate 4 has a through groove, and an elastic rod 136 fixed to the top of the connecting frame 11 and located above the force-bearing rod 134. The elastic rod 136 will bend when subjected to force.

[0052] When the connecting frame 11 moves downward, it will drive the connecting rod 135 and the elastic rod 136 to move downward, so that the elastic rod 136 is close to the force rod 134. When the top of the shock-absorbing pad is flush with the top of the positioning sleeve 5, the elastic rod 136 will contact the force rod 134 and push the force rod 134 downward, so that the force rod 134 can drive the rotating column 132 to rotate. When the force rod 134 contacts the positioning plate 4 and cannot rotate, and the connecting rod 135 and the elastic rod 136 continue to move downward, the elastic rod 136 will bend and move with the connecting rod 135 to below the positioning plate 4.

[0053] When the connecting frame 11 moves the connecting rod 135 and the elastic rod 136 upward, the elastic rod 136 contacts the bottom of the force rod 134, which pushes the force rod 134 to rotate upward and reset, and causes the rotating column 132 to drive the two cutters 8 to reset. At this time, the force rod 134 cannot rotate, and when the connecting rod 135 and the elastic rod 136 continue to move upward, the elastic rod 136 will bend and move above the force rod 134.

[0054] Example 3, referring to Figure 2 and Figure 3 This is the third embodiment of the present invention, which is based on the first two embodiments.

[0055] Specifically, there are two sets of moving units 14, located on both sides of the support plate 9. The moving unit 14 includes a connecting plate 141 fixed on one side of the support plate 9, a second cylinder 142 located at the bottom of the connecting plate 141, the top of the second cylinder 142 being hinged to the connecting plate 141 via a hinge seat, a threaded rod 143 being rotatably connected to the top of the base 1 via a mounting block, the bottom of the second cylinder 142 being threadedly connected to the threaded rod 143 via a slider, and a motor 144 located at one end of the threaded rod 143, with the output end of the motor 144 being fixed to the threaded rod 143.

[0056] When the upper mold is opened, the starter motor 144 drives the threaded rod 143 to rotate. The threaded rod 143 drives the second cylinder 142 and the connecting plate 141 to move through the slider, so that the support plate 9 moves to below the upper mold. Then, the second cylinder 142 is started to push the connecting plate 141 and the support plate 9 to move upward, so that the positioning sleeve 5 is placed on the outside of the shock-absorbing pad. Then, the second cylinder 142 drives the support plate 9 and the positioning sleeve 5 to move downward, and completes the removal of the shock-absorbing pad.

[0057] The moving unit 14 also includes a fixed plate 145 fixed to one side of the second cylinder 142, and a third cylinder 146 fixed to the top of the fixed plate 145. The output end of the third cylinder 146 is connected to the connecting plate 141 through the cooperation of the slide rail and the sliding shaft. When it is below the upper mold, the third cylinder 146 moves up and down synchronously with the second cylinder 142. When the support plate 9 moves outward and the moving sleeve 6 takes the shock-absorbing pad out of the positioning sleeve 5, the third cylinder 146 is started and the connecting plate 141 and the support plate 9 are tilted downward through the cooperation of the slide rail and the sliding shaft. This allows the shock-absorbing pad that is separated from the moving sleeve 6 and the positioning sleeve 5 at the top of the support plate 9 to roll to one side and separate from the support plate 9. It can be collected below through the collection box. At this time, the residual waste material cut off flows to the top of the positioning plate 4, which can be cleaned by the staff with an air gun.
